Characteristics of a Car That Has Been Submerged in a Flood

Characteristics of a Car That Has Been Submerged in a Flood

Flooding is a natural disaster that often causes significant damage to infrastructure, property, and personal belongings. One of the most affected items in such events is vehicles, as they are particularly vulnerable to water damage. A car that has been submerged in a flood can exhibit a wide range of issues, some of which may not be immediately apparent. For both car buyers and owners, recognizing these characteristics is crucial to prevent long-term problems or making a poor investment.

This article delves into the signs, symptoms, and consequences of flood damage in vehicles, explaining why flood-damaged cars are considered high-risk and how to identify these issues.

 1. Exterior Damage

At first glance, the exterior of a car may not reveal the full extent of flood damage, but there are still some key signs that a vehicle has been submerged in water:

- Waterlines: After floodwaters recede, a distinct waterline can often be found on the body of the car, particularly around the wheel wells or doors. This line is a clear indicator that the vehicle has been exposed to deep water.
  
- Corrosion and Rust: Metal surfaces are highly susceptible to rust when exposed to water for extended periods. Rust may develop on the car’s undercarriage, door hinges, and in hard-to-reach areas such as the interior components of the engine or behind body panels. The presence of rust in unusual areas can be a significant red flag for flood damage.

- Fogged Headlights and Tail Lights: Moisture trapped inside the car’s light fixtures can cause them to appear foggy or misty. This happens when floodwater enters the lights and fails to dry out completely, leaving condensation behind.

- Damaged Paint: Floodwater often contains debris, chemicals, and other contaminants that can damage a car’s paint. This may cause peeling, chipping, or discoloration in certain areas of the vehicle, especially if it was submerged for an extended period.

 2. Interior Issues

The interior of a flood-damaged car will often reveal more obvious signs of water exposure. Common issues inside the vehicle include:

- Water Stains and Mud Residue: One of the most telltale signs of a car that has been submerged is the presence of water stains or mud residue on the upholstery, carpeting, or inside the glove compartment. The seats and carpets may appear discolored, and the fabric may have a distinct waterline or feel damp, even after drying.

- Unusual Odors: A persistent musty or mildew smell is one of the most prominent indicators of flood damage. When water gets into a vehicle’s interior, it can saturate the upholstery, carpet, and insulation, leading to mold and mildew growth if not thoroughly dried out. The smell may be impossible to eliminate completely without replacing the affected components.

- Mold and Mildew Growth: Besides unpleasant odors, visible mold or mildew may begin to form in the car’s interior if it has been exposed to water for an extended period. Mold can grow in hard-to-reach areas like under the seats, behind the dashboard, and in the air conditioning vents.

- Electrical Component FailuresWater and electronics do not mix well. Floodwaters can severely damage a car’s electrical systems, leading to various issues such as malfunctioning dashboard lights, power windows, door locks, and entertainment systems. Electrical systems may exhibit erratic behavior, and even if they seem to function initially, corrosion from water exposure can cause problems down the road.

 3. Engine and Mechanical Damage

The mechanical systems of a car are particularly vulnerable to flood damage, and their failure can render a vehicle completely unusable. Some of the most common mechanical issues that arise in flood-damaged cars include:

- Contaminated Fluids: Floodwater can seep into critical engine fluids, including engine oil, transmission fluid, brake fluid, and power steering fluid. When these fluids become contaminated with water, they lose their lubricating and cooling properties, leading to internal damage and, ultimately, system failure. Checking for milky or cloudy oil and fluids is a clear sign that water has made its way into the engine.

- Hydrolock: One of the most devastating consequences of driving a car through floodwaters is hydrolock. This occurs when water enters the engine’s cylinders, preventing the pistons from moving. Because water is incompressible, the pistons cannot complete their stroke, which can cause catastrophic damage to the engine’s internals, often leading to a total engine rebuild or replacement.

- Corroded Engine Components: Even if water does not immediately cause visible damage, it can lead to corrosion in critical engine components. Over time, parts such as the starter motor, alternator, and fuel injectors may become corroded, leading to mechanical failure. This corrosion can be difficult to detect at first, but it can cause major issues in the long run.

- Transmission Problems: Floodwater can also damage a car’s transmission. If water seeps into the transmission fluid, it can lead to slipping gears, rough shifting, and eventual transmission failure. Like engine damage, transmission problems can be expensive and complicated to repair.

 4. Electrical System Complications

Modern cars rely heavily on complex electrical systems, which are highly susceptible to water damage. When a car is submerged, water can infiltrate these systems and cause immediate and long-term issues:

- Malfunctioning Sensors: Flood-damaged cars may exhibit erratic or malfunctioning sensors. These could include parking sensors, tire pressure monitors, and engine management sensors. Because these systems are often difficult to inspect without specialized equipment, hidden electrical damage may not be immediately apparent.

- Faulty Wiring: Water can corrode and damage the wiring throughout the vehicle, causing short circuits and erratic behavior. The insulation around the wires may degrade, leading to exposed connections, which can cause a fire hazard. Inspecting the wiring harness and connections is essential when determining the extent of water damage.

- Computer Module Failures: Most modern cars feature a central computer module, which controls many of the vehicle's functions, including the engine, transmission, and infotainment system. If water gets into the computer module, it can cause erratic behavior, system failure, or even permanent damage that may require costly replacement.

5. Undercarriage and Suspension Damage

While the body and interior of a car often show the most visible signs of flood damage, the undercarriage and suspension systems are equally vulnerable:

- Rust and Corrosion: As mentioned earlier, rust and corrosion can occur anywhere on a vehicle that has been submerged, and the undercarriage is particularly susceptible due to its exposure to water and debris. Rust can weaken structural components, leading to safety concerns and reducing the lifespan of the vehicle.

- Brake System Damage: The braking system is another critical area that can be damaged by floodwaters. Water may seep into the brake lines, causing rust and corrosion on the rotors, calipers, and drums. This can lead to reduced braking performance or complete brake failure.

- Suspension Issues: Floodwater can damage the suspension system by causing corrosion in the joints, bushings, and bearings. Over time, this can lead to premature wear and reduced ride quality. It may also make the vehicle more difficult to handle, potentially compromising safety.

 Conclusion

A car that has been submerged in a flood may exhibit a wide array of problems, ranging from visible damage to hidden mechanical and electrical issues. While some damage may be immediately apparent, much of it can take time to manifest, especially in critical systems such as the engine, transmission, and electrical components. As a result, flood-damaged cars are often considered high-risk, especially when not properly inspected and repaired.

For potential buyers, it is essential to conduct a thorough inspection or have a professional mechanic evaluate the vehicle for signs of water damage. Similarly, for car owners whose vehicles have been submerged, addressing the damage as soon as possible is crucial to preventing long-term complications.

Flood damage is a serious issue, and cars that have been affected by it may suffer from reduced reliability, safety concerns, and diminished resale value. Understanding the characteristics of a flood-damaged car can help both buyers and owners avoid costly mistakes and ensure that their vehicles remain safe and operational.
